Lawler, Sally H.; Olson, Elizabeth A.; Chapleski, Elizabeth E. – Behavioral & Social Sciences Librarian, 1999
Describes the use of an autobiographical writing assignment to orient older, non-traditional students, and students in social work-related fields, to the library and its resources based on experiences in a graduate gerontology course at Wayne State University. Moody, Regina – School Library Media Activities Monthly, 1997
Describes a program developed collaboratively between a school library media specialist and a teacher for a fifth-grade language arts class on writing a research paper. Goals, including shared library resources and the use of print and electronic materials; sequence of lessons; and student reactions are discussed. (LRW)
